Algerian Singer Cheb Nasro Urges Morocco-Algeria Border Reopening at Raï Festival

While participating in the International Raï Festival held in the city of Oujda, Morocco, Cheb Nasro, the Algerian raï singer, called on the Algerian and Moroccan authorities on Saturday, July 20, to open the borders.
After more than 20 years of absence from the music scene, the Algerian singer Cheb Nasro set foot on Moroccan soil. At the International Raï Festival in which he participated, he took the opportunity to make a heartfelt appeal to the Moroccan and Algerian authorities, reports observalgerie.com.
Indeed, Cheb Nasro pleaded for the opening of the borders between these two neighboring countries, all the more so since there are social, linguistic and religious ties between the Algerian and Moroccan peoples. For the singer, the Maghreb countries can be inspired by the good neighborly relations between the countries of the European Union. The one who is called Nasereddine Souidi, in civil status, is optimistic about the opening of the Algerian-Moroccan border, for the happiness of the two peoples.
Since 1994, the border between Algeria and Morocco has remained closed. At the origin of this decision, an accusation that provoked the anger of the Algerian authorities. Indeed, Morocco had accused the Algerian intelligence services of being involved in an attack targeting a hotel in Marrakech.
